Renowned scholars, Anirudh Deshpande, Harish Trivedi and Sadiq-ur-Rahman Kidwai, discussed ‘Fort William College: Revisiting Urdu-Hindi Divide. Anirudh Deshpande is an associate professor, Department of History, University of Delhi. He has to his credit several publications including The British Raj and its Indian Armed Forces, 1857-1939, British Military Policy in India 1900-1945: Colonial Constraints and Declining Power, Class, Power and Consciousness in Indian Cinema and Television, Issues in Twentieth-Century World History, The First Line of Defence–Glorious 50 Years of the Border Security Force. A former Nehru Memorial Museum and Library Fellow, Deshpande has published numerous papers in acclaimed journals. Harish Trivedi, formerly a Professor in the Department of English, Delhi University, is a widely celebrated scholar of post-colonialism, comparative and translation studies. He has authored Colonial Transactions: English Literature in India, co-authored Literature and Nation: Britain and India (1800-1990), and edited/co-edited The Nation Across the World, Postcolonial Translation: Theory and Practice, Interrogating Postcolonialism: Theory, Text and Context, and Inter-Disciplinary Alter-natives in Comparative Literature. He has lectured widely in India, USA, UK, Canada, and Australia. A well-known Urdu critic and academician, Sadiq-ur-Rahman Kidwai is a former dean of the School of Languages, Jawaharlal Nehru University. Currently, he is the secretary of Ghalib Institute, a renowned educational and cultural institution in Delhi. Kidwai is also a member of the Goethe Society of India. In 2010, he was awarded the prestigious Padma Shri by the government of India. Anisur Rahman, formerly a professor of English at Jamia Millia Islamia, New Delhi, is currently Senior Advisor at Rekhta Foundation. He has worked and published in the areas of postcolonial, translation, comparative and Urdu studies. His most recent publications include Earthenware, a collection of his English poems, and Hazaaron Kwahishein Aisi: The Wonderful World of Urdu Ghazals, a selection Urdu ghazal in English translation from the sixteenth century to now.
